Comprehending PCI Compliance and Secure Payment Handling
In today's digital landscape, safeguarding sensitive payment information is paramount. P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ard) is a comprehensive set of requirements designed to ensure the secure handling of credit card and other payment data. Agreement with PCI DSS involves implementing robust security measures to protect against|data breaches, fraud, and unauthorized access.
Businesses that process, store, or transmit cardholder data are mandated to comply with PCI DSS. Failure to do so can result in severe financial penalties, reputational damage, and legal ramifications. Understanding the key aspects of PCI DSS, such as network security, access control, and data encryption, is crucial for businesses to maintain a secure payment environment.
- Deploying firewalls and intrusion detection systems
- Encrypting cardholder data both in transit and at rest
- Conducting regular security assessments and vulnerability scans
- Training employees on secure payment handling practices
By adhering to PCI DSS guidelines, businesses can minimize the risk of data breaches and protect their customers' sensitive information. Committing in security measures is a vital step in building customer trust and maintaining a secure online environment.
